What Happened?
NFI North (referred to in state filings as “NFI North”) detected unauthorized activity in its network environment on September 6, 2025. Third-party forensic specialists were engaged, and the company confirmed that an unknown actor exfiltrated files containing personal information. The review determined on November 5, 2025 that specific consumer data was included in the stolen files. The ongoing investigation has not uncovered evidence of misuse, but the organization began mailing notification letters on November 13, 2025, in compliance with state law.
What Information Was Exposed?
The preliminary analysis shows that the following data elements may have been accessed:
- First and last name
- Social Security number
Company Response
According to the notice filed with the Maine Attorney General, NFI North took these steps after discovering the intrusion:
- Engaged external forensics firms to secure and investigate the network
- Wiped and rebuilt affected systems and strengthened network safeguards
- Reviewed and updated internal policies, procedures, and security software
- Notified the FBI and is cooperating with the agency’s investigation
- Offering complimentary single-bureau credit monitoring, credit reports, credit scores, and proactive fraud assistance through Cyberscout (a TransUnion company)

Company Overview
NFI North is a nonprofit human services organization founded in 1992. Headquarters are located at 40 Park Lane, Contoocook, New Hampshire, United States. The nonprofit employs approximately 400 people and delivers community-based behavioral health and educational programs.
